I am looking for the identities of the 6 PTs which mistakenly torpedoed USS McCawley in Blanche Channel on the night of 6/30/43.

Brian: The boats involved were from Ron 9, commanded by Bob Kelly of "Expendable" fame. According to the AARs, the boats were PTs-118,153,158,159,160 and 162, with hits probably being scored on MCCAWLEY by the 118 and 153 boats.
